Choosing the Right Bonus – What to Look For
Bonuses are the main lure for Canadian players, but not all are created equal. The headline “100% match up to $500” looks great until you read the fine print: wagering requirements, eligible games, and expiration dates can turn a sweet deal into a headache.
When comparing offers, keep an eye on these factors:
- Wagering requirements: 20x–40x the bonus amount is typical.
- Game restrictions: Some bonuses apply only to slots, others include table games.
- Maximum cash‑out: A cap of $200 on winnings is common for low‑roll players.
- Expiration: Many bonuses must be used within 7–14 days.
Beyond the welcome package, look for reload bonuses, free spins, and loyalty programmes that reward regular play without excessive strings attached.
Payment Methods – Deposits and Withdrawals
Canada has a wide range of payment options, from Interac e‑Transfer to major credit cards and e‑wallets. Your choice influences how fast you can start playing and how quickly you can take your winnings out.
Below is a quick comparison of the most popular methods for Canadian players:
| Deposit Method | Processing Time | Typical Fees | Withdrawal Speed |
|---|---|---|---|
| Interac e‑Transfer | Instant | None | 1–2 business days |
| Visa / MasterCard | Instant | 1–2% per transaction | 2–5 business days |
| PayPal | Instant | ~2% (may vary) | Same day to next day |
| Bank Transfer (EFT) | Up to 24 hrs | None | 1–3 business days |
Remember that withdrawals often trigger a secondary verification step, so keep your ID documents and proof of payment accessible. Most reputable sites process withdrawals within 24 hours once the request is approved.

Security, Licensing and Responsible Gambling
A trustworthy online casino Canada will display its licence number prominently – usually issued by the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, or a provincial regulator like the AGCO. Licensing means the operator is audited for fairness and must use SSL encryption to protect your data.
Responsible gambling tools are also mandatory. Good sites provide deposit limits, self‑exclusion options, and links to support organisations such as the Canadian Centre on Substance Abuse. If you ever feel your play is getting out of hand, those features are there to help you step back safely.

Fast Withdrawals – What Influences Speed
Withdrawal speed isn’t just about the payment processor. The casino’s internal review, your verification status, and the amount you’re cashing out all play a role. Smaller sums (< $500) often qualify for “instant payouts” on e‑wallets, while larger withdrawals may require additional checks.
To keep your money flowing, complete the KYC verification as soon as possible, set up two‑factor authentication, and stick to the same deposit method for withdrawals when the casino allows it. This reduces the chance of a manual review delaying your payout.
